- 2
- 0
- 约4.19千字
- 约 24页
- 2017-11-22 发布于江苏
- 举报
第四章数字化测图软件开发
第三章 数字化测图软件开发 §3.1 软件开发的基础知识 §3.1.1软件开发与软件危机 一、软件定义 软件是指计算机实现各种功能的逻辑部件,是人类创造的最强大工具。 二、软件开发的特点: 1)进程难以控制 2)质量评价难 3)维护与修改难 三、软件危机 1)定义:软件开发与维护过程中遇到的一系列严重问题的统称。 2)软件危机的表现 a、软件开发成本和进度开发不正确 b、用户对产品的不满意现象经常出现 c、产品质量可靠性差 d、软件可维护性差 e、软件缺乏适当的文档资料 f、软件成本在计算机系统中所占的比例逐年增加 g、软件开发生产率与计算机应用发展速度相差大 3)软件危机解决方法 a、提高开发与管理人员的认识,树立“工程”概念 b、注意推广成功的技术和方法,并探索更好的方法。 c、注意选择支撑环境 §3.1.2软件工程学的基本原则 针对出现的软件危机及其原因,进行研究进而提出了一门新的学科---软件工程学,并提出软件工程的基本原则: 1)用分阶段的生命周期法进行软件计划,严格进行管理。 2)坚持阶段评审。 3)实行严格产品质量控制,不能随意改变需求。 4)采用现代化程序设计技术 5)软件开发结果应能清楚审查
原创力文档

文档评论(0)